Summary
Robotic surgery using the da Vinci Xi system offers a precise approach for Pancoast tumour resection, improving outcomes for these challenging lung apex cancers. This method enhances visualization and dexterity for complex surgeries.

Background:
- Pancoast tumours, rare lung apex cancers, present significant surgical challenges due to invasion of critical adjacent structures.
- Historically considered inoperable, multimodal therapy has improved outcomes, but conventional open surgery has high morbidity.
- Advancements in robotic-assisted thoracic surgery offer potential improvements in managing these complex cases.
Purpose of the Study:
- To demonstrate the application of robotic-assisted Pancoast tumour resection using the da Vinci Xi surgical system.
- To highlight the perioperative management strategies for robotic Pancoast tumour resection.
- To review patient outcomes following robotic-assisted surgical management.
Main Methods:
- Video tutorial detailing robotic-assisted Pancoast tumour resection using the da Vinci Xi platform.
- Focus on surgical technique, instrument utilization, and port placement.
- Discussion of perioperative care and patient selection.
Main Results:
- Robotic-assisted surgery provides enhanced 3D visualization and dexterity for complex resections.
- Potential for reduced morbidity and improved recovery compared to open techniques.
- Demonstration of feasibility for Pancoast tumour resection with the da Vinci Xi system.
Conclusions:
- Robotic-assisted thoracic surgery represents a transformative approach for Pancoast tumour resection.
- The da Vinci Xi system offers advantages in precision and visualization for these challenging cases.
- Further research into long-term outcomes is warranted.
